Literature summary for 1.3.1.9 extracted from

  • Maity, K.; Bhargav, S.P.; Sankaran, B.; Surolia, N.; Surolia, A.; Suguna, K.
    X-ray crystallographic analysis of the complexes of enoyl acyl carrier protein reductase of Plasmodium falciparum with triclosan variants to elucidate the importance of different functional groups in enzyme inhibition (2010), IUBMB Life, 62, 467-476.

Crystallization (Commentary)

Crystallization (Comment) Organism
X-ray crystal structures of Plasmodium falciparum enzyme in complex with triclosan variants having different substituted and unsubstituted groups at different key functional locations. 4 and 2' substituted compounds have more interactions with the protein, cofactor, and solvents when compared with triclosan. Substitution at the 2' position of triclosan causes the relocation of a conserved water molecule, leading to an additional hydrogen bond with the inhibitor. 2' and 4' unsubstituted compounds show a movement away from the hydrophobic pocket to compensate for the interactions made by the halogen groups of triclosan Plasmodium falciparum

Inhibitors

Inhibitors Comment Organism Structure
2-(2-amino-4-chlorophenoxy)-5-chlorophenol IC50 for Plasmodium falciparum in culture 0.0084 mM Plasmodium falciparum
3-hydroxy-4-phenoxybenzaldehyde IC50 for Plasmodium falciparum in culture 0.077 mM Plasmodium falciparum
4-(2,4-dichlorophenoxy)-3-hydroxybenzaldehyde IC50 for Plasmodium falciparum in culture 0.021 mM Plasmodium falciparum
